Package: phppgadmin
Version: 5.1+ds-4
Severity: important
Hi,
it seems things changed in PostgreSQL system tables; trying to show functions
throws this error (translated from Italian):
======================================= 8<
=======================================
SQL Error:
ERROR: p.proisagg column doesn't exist
LINE 18: WHERE NOT p.proisagg
^
HINT: Perhaps you wanted to reference column "p.prolang" instead.
In query:
SELECT
p.oid AS prooid,
p.proname,
p.proretset,
pg_catalog.format_type(p.prorettype, NULL) AS
proresult,
pg_catalog.oidvectortypes(p.proargtypes) AS
proarguments,
pl.lanname AS prolanguage,
pg_catalog.obj_description(p.oid, 'pg_proc') AS
procomment,
p.proname || ' (' ||
pg_catalog.oidvectortypes(p.proargtypes) || ')' AS proproto,
CASE WHEN p.proretset THEN 'setof ' ELSE '' END
|| pg_catalog.format_type(p.prorettype, NULL) AS proreturns,
u.usename AS proowner
FROM pg_catalog.pg_proc p
INNER JOIN pg_catalog.pg_namespace n ON n.oid =
p.pronamespace
INNER JOIN pg_catalog.pg_language pl ON pl.oid
= p.prolang
LEFT JOIN pg_catalog.pg_user u ON u.usesysid =
p.proowner
WHERE NOT p.proisagg
AND n.nspname = 'xxxxxxxx'
ORDER BY p.proname, proresult
======================================= >8
=======================================
v5.6 is available on project's homepage (1) and PostgreSQL v11 is going to be
released in Buster: can the version be aligned with upstream?
Thanks
(1) http://phppgadmin.sourceforge.net/doku.php
P.S.: please ignore system info: phppgadmin is installed on a different box
-- System Information:
Debian Release: buster/sid
APT prefers testing
APT policy: (990, 'testing'), (500, 'proposed-updates'), (500, 'unstable'),
(500, 'stable'), (500, 'oldstable'), (1, 'experimental')
Architecture: amd64 (x86_64)
Foreign Architectures: i386
Kernel: Linux 5.0.0-6.slh.1-aptosid-amd64 (SMP w/4 CPU cores; PREEMPT)
Kernel taint flags: TAINT_PROPRIETARY_MODULE, TAINT_OOT_MODULE
Locale: LANG=it_IT.UTF-8, LC_CTYPE=it_IT.UTF-8 (charmap=UTF-8), LANGUAGE=it
(charmap=UTF-8)
Shell: /bin/sh linked to /bin/dash
Init: systemd (via /run/systemd/system)
Versions of packages phppgadmin depends on:
ii dpkg 1.19.6
pn libapache2-mod-php | php-cgi | php <none>
ii libjs-jquery 3.3.1~dfsg-1
pn libphp-adodb <none>
pn php-pgsql <none>
Versions of packages phppgadmin recommends:
pn apache2 | httpd <none>
Versions of packages phppgadmin suggests:
pn postgresql <none>
pn postgresql-doc <none>
pn slony1-bin <none>